What is a Door Contractor?
A door contractor is a competent professional who concentrates on the installation, repair, and upkeep of doors in residential and industrial properties. They have substantial understanding of different door materials, styles, and hardware, enabling them to supply customized solutions for numerous consumer needs. From selecting the best door to its installation, a door contractor is necessary for making sure that the doors work properly and enhance the visual appeal of a space.
Secret Responsibilities of a Door Contractor
Assessment and Assessment: A door contractor starts by examining the particular requirements of a task. This frequently includes evaluating existing doors and hardware, talking about design choices, and advising appropriate alternatives.
Installation: After selecting the suitable door and hardware, the contractor continues with installation. This involves accurate measurements, cutting, fitting, and making sure that all elements are firmly attached.
Repair and Maintenance: A door contractor also focuses on repairing doors, consisting of fixing frames, replacing hardware, and changing hinges. Regular maintenance services can assist prolong the life of doors and boost their efficiency.
Customization: In some cases, customers may need custom doors that fit special spaces or match specific style visual appeals. An experienced door contractor will work with various materials and surfaces to produce bespoke services.
Compliance with Building Codes: Door contractors are well-informed about local building codes and regulations, making sure that all installations fulfill security standards.

Common FAQs about Door ContractorsWhat is the average cost of hiring a door contractor?
The cost can vary substantially based on the kind of door, complexity of installation, and regional pricing. On average, homeowners can anticipate to pay between ₤ 200 and ₤ 1000, including materials and labor.
For how long does it take to set up a door?
The installation time can differ based upon the door type and the contractor's knowledge. Normally, a straightforward installation can take anywhere from 2 to five hours.
Are door repairs worth it, or should I simply replace the door?
It depends on the level of the damage. Small repair work-- like repairing broken hinges or changing hardware-- are generally worth it, while severely damaged doors might need changing for safety and visual reasons.
How do I know if my door needs replacing?
Signs that a Entry Door Installer may require replacing consist of warping, cracks, trouble opening and closing, rust (in metal doors), or bad insulation.
Can I install a door myself?
While DIY installation is possible, it requires understanding of woodworking, precise measurements, and an understanding of door mechanics. Working with a professional is frequently recommended for optimum results.
